What problem does it solve?

GEO-first visibility assessments help you determine whether your website can be discovered, understood, and cited by AI-powered search engines and LLM-based answer platforms, rather than relying only on traditional keyword rankings.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Run full GEO audits: discover key pages, check AI crawler access, analyze technical SEO foundations, score content citability and E-E-A-T, validate structured data, and produce a prioritized action plan.
  • Generate deliverables: create client-ready Markdown reports and optionally produce a branded PDF report with charts and a score breakdown.
  • Target specific GEO dimensions: run focused commands for citability scoring, crawler access via robots.txt, llms.txt analysis/generation, schema markup, content quality, brand mention scanning, and platform-specific optimization.
  • Maintain a prospect pipeline: manage GEO prospects and proposals with CRM-lite views (CLI and web UI) and track GEO score deltas over time.

What is a GEO audit and how does it check AI search visibility?

A GEO audit assesses whether your website can be discovered and cited by AI-powered search engines. It checks AI crawler access via robots.txt, scores content citability, validates schema markup, and analyzes E-E-A-T signals to produce an AI readiness action plan.

How do I check if AI crawlers can access my site for LLM citations?

You can check AI crawler access by analyzing your robots.txt file to see if it blocks AI search engine bots. A GEO audit performs this robots.txt analysis automatically, verifying that LLM-based answer platforms can crawl and index your content.
